其實準確的說不能叫CAN網(wǎng)關, 應該叫網(wǎng)關或者汽車網(wǎng)關, 因為網(wǎng)關不僅處理CAN網(wǎng)絡, 還處理LIN網(wǎng)絡。
主要是為了配合本系列教程及區(qū)分于以太網(wǎng)網(wǎng)關, 所以才取名叫CAN網(wǎng)關。
CAN網(wǎng)關的外形結(jié)構(gòu)
大概外形如上, 偶有差異, 大小如香煙煙盒, 有60,70多個PIN腳組成。
每個接線pin腳都有嚴格的定義, 嚴格定義了要接can總線或者開關設備等。..
從以上拓撲圖可以看出:
CAN網(wǎng)關除了10個can接線pin腳(5條雙絞線/5條CAN總線),2個電源線接線pin腳,還應包括定速巡航設備的8個接線pin腳,電源管理方面的3個接線pin腳,鑰匙開關(或無鑰匙啟動系統(tǒng))的5個接線pin腳,腳踏板的3個接線pin腳,5個LIN接線pin腳, 檔位開關的4個接線pin腳等等。..。
某些汽車廠商可能有更多新的硬件開關設備,電壓電阻開關設備等也都有對應的接線pin腳, 且可能預留一些PIN腳以備用。
CAN網(wǎng)關的功能
CAN網(wǎng)關是整個CAN網(wǎng)絡的核心, 控制著整車5條CAN總線的各類信號轉(zhuǎn)發(fā)與處理。
CAN網(wǎng)關的基本功能包括:
- 1. 連接不同波特率(傳輸速度)的CAN總線/LIN總線,以實現(xiàn)CAN網(wǎng)絡的網(wǎng)關中繼功能。
- 2. 診斷報文/非診斷報文轉(zhuǎn)發(fā)
- 3. 診斷防火墻管理
- 4. 節(jié)點在線監(jiān)控
- 5. 巡航控制器開關檢測
- 6. 腳踏板位置檢測
- 7. 網(wǎng)關休眠與喚醒管理
- 8. ECU升級/網(wǎng)關升級
- 9. 電壓管理
簡單點說:
CAN網(wǎng)關可以接收任何CAN總線(還有LIN總線)傳來的不同傳輸速率網(wǎng)絡信號,
CAN網(wǎng)關把這些信號按一定的標準處理后, 廣播到整車網(wǎng)絡去,
如果有ECU訂閱(接收)了這個信號, 則ECU將解析信號并做相應的處理。
沒理解不了, 請看下方實例!
CAN網(wǎng)關的CAN信號轉(zhuǎn)發(fā)機制
實例一: 儀表顯示發(fā)動機轉(zhuǎn)速
發(fā)動機的轉(zhuǎn)速信號, 先從PCAN的ECM(發(fā)動機引擎控制模塊)節(jié)點發(fā)出, CAN網(wǎng)關收到后,
網(wǎng)關處理后廣播以GW_開頭的ECM信號到其他4條CAN總線上去。
用Vehicle Spy 3 CAN工具查看可以看到以下的信號內(nèi)容:
ECAN上的儀表(IPK)節(jié)點訂閱(接收)了發(fā)動機轉(zhuǎn)速信號,
則會將這個轉(zhuǎn)速信號解析, 并顯示到儀表盤去。
由于以上信號發(fā)送頻率太快, 比如上圖的9.94ms/次, 則你就會看到儀表盤上的轉(zhuǎn)速
指針一直在不停地偏動。
簡略發(fā)送圖如下:
實例二: 安全帶未扣緊, 儀表端報警
安全帶未扣緊需要兩個條件:
1. 車速大于5
2. 安全帶扣未扣 ( 即無電壓信號 )
車速一般是PCAN上的ECM(發(fā)動機引擎控制模塊)節(jié)點負責信號管理的。
安全帶扣這個設備是BCAN上的BCM(負責天窗, 車窗, 安全帶扣, 雨刮等車身零部件設備。..) 節(jié)點負責信號管理的。
即網(wǎng)關收到PCAN上的ECM節(jié)點發(fā)出來的車速信號, 并收到了BCAN上的BCM發(fā)出來的安全帶扣電壓值為異常值(比如0), CAN網(wǎng)關統(tǒng)一處理后轉(zhuǎn)發(fā)并廣播以GW_開頭的信號幀,
ECAN上的儀表(IPK)節(jié)點訂閱(接收)了GW_開頭的相關安全帶未扣信號幀
則會解析報警并顯示到儀表盤去。
如果安全帶扣一直未扣緊, 則CAN網(wǎng)關將一直發(fā)送GW_開頭的相關安全帶信號幀,
其信號值是安全帶未扣緊
所以車主會聽到一直報警。
直到安全帶扣上, CAN網(wǎng)關繼續(xù)發(fā)送安全帶相關的信號,
只是這個時候的信號值是安全帶已扣緊
報警將立馬消失。
簡略發(fā)送圖如下:
總結(jié):
以上只是兩個簡易的案例, 實際上, 整車所有ECU基本是以毫秒級或者微妙級的速度在源源不斷的發(fā)送并接收信號, 所以網(wǎng)關需要處理并轉(zhuǎn)發(fā)廣播的信號是非常多的且必須要很快處理完的.
編輯:hfy
-
以太網(wǎng)
+關注
關注
40文章
5439瀏覽量
171965 -
CAN
+關注
關注
57文章
2756瀏覽量
463893 -
CAN網(wǎng)絡
+關注
關注
1文章
44瀏覽量
16957
發(fā)布評論請先 登錄
相關推薦
評論